BACKGROUND AND PURPOSE: While changes in ventricular and extraventricular CSF spaces have been studied following shunt placement in patients with idiopathic normal pressure hydrocephalus, regional changes in cortical volumes have not. These changes are important to better inform disease pathophysiology and evaluation for copathology. The purpose of this work is to investigate changes in ventricular and cortical volumes in patients with idiopathic normal pressure hydrocephalus following ventriculoperitoneal shunt placement. MATERIALS AND METHODS: This is a retrospective cohort study of patients with idiopathic normal pressure hydrocephalus who underwent 3D T1-weighted MR imaging before and after ventriculoperitoneal shunt placement. Images were analyzed using tensor-based morphometry with symmetric normalization to determine the percentage change in ventricular and regional cortical volumes. Ventricular volume changes were assessed using the Wilcoxon signed rank test, and cortical volume changes, using a linear mixed-effects model (P < .05). RESULTS: The study included 22 patients (5 women/17 men; mean age, 73 [SD, 6] years). Ventricular volume decreased after shunt placement with a mean change of -15.4% (P < .001). Measured cortical volume across all participants and cortical ROIs showed a mean percentage increase of 1.4% (P < .001). ROIs near the vertex showed the greatest percentage increase in volume after shunt placement, with smaller decreases in volume in the medial temporal lobes. CONCLUSIONS: Overall, cortical volumes mildly increased after shunt placement in patients with idiopathic normal pressure hydrocephalus with the greatest increases in regions near the vertex, indicating postshunt decompression of the cortex and sulci. Ventricular volumes showed an expected decrease after shunt placement.

BACKGROUND: Psychiatric disorders may occur in patients with intractable partial epilepsy after surgical treatment. Previous reports attributed the presence of psychological adverse events to specific pathological entities such as dysembryoplastic neuroepithelial tumors (DNETs) and gangliogliomas. The rationale for the present study is to evaluate the importance of the surgical pathology in individuals undergoing epilepsy surgery. METHODS: The patients were separated into three groups based on the surgical pathology: group I ganglioglioma (N=25), group II DNETs (N=25), and group III mesial temporal sclerosis (N=25). Thirteen of the 75 patients (17.3%) had a preexisting psychiatric disorder. The most common preoperative psychiatric diagnosis was depression (N=4). Sixty-three of the lesions (84%) were restricted to the temporal lobe. The operative strategy included resection of the lesion and epileptogenic cortex. Sixty-two of the 75 patients (83%) were rendered seizure-free. RESULTS: Eight of the 75 patients (10.7%) had an acquired psychiatric illness following surgical treatment. A mood disorder developed in three patients after surgery. No statistical difference emerged in preoperative psychiatric co-morbidity (no group difference; p=1.0) or in newly diagnosed postoperative psychiatric disease (group I vs. II, p=0.67; group I vs. III, p=1.0; and group II vs. III, p=0.67) within the three surgical pathology groups. CONCLUSION: This study indicates that the presence of psychiatric disease before and after surgery for intractable partial epilepsy, predominantly of temporal lobe origin, was independent of the pathological findings.

This experiment examined the effects of nitric oxide (NO) synthase inhibition on brain intracellular pH, regional cortical blood flow, and NADH fluorescence before and during 3 h of focal cerebral ischemia using in vivo fluorescence imaging. Thirty fasted rabbits under 1% halothane were divided into four treatment groups receiving N omega-nitro-L-arginine methyl ester (L-NAME) intravenously at 20 min prior to ischemia (0.1, 1, and 10 mg/kg and 1 mg/kg + 5 mg/kg L-arginine) and two control groups (nonischemic and ischemic). In ischemic controls, brain pH(i), declined to 6.73 +/- 0.03 at 30 min and remained acidotic through the remainder of the ischemic period. In the 0.1 mg/kg group, brain pH(i) fell after 30 min of ischemia to 6.76 +/- 0.05 (p < 0.05), but then improved progressively despite occlusion. In the 1 mg/kg group, brain pH(i), remained normal despite middle cerebral artery (MCA) occlusion. In the 10 mg/kg group and in the combined L-NAME + L-arginine group, pH(i) fell after 30 min of ischemia to 6.81 +/- 0.03 (p < 0.05) and remained acidotic. During occlusion, regional cortical blood flow dropped in a dose-dependent manner. After 3 h of ischemia, regional cortical blood flow was 33.9 +/- 10.9 and 25.1 +/- 8.9 ml/100 g/min at doses of 0.1 and 10.0 mg/kg, respectively, L-NAME treatment did not significantly alter the increased NADH fluorescence that accompanied occlusion. This study shows that L-NAME can prevent intracellular brain acidosis during focal cerebral ischemia independent from regional cortical blood flow changes. This experiment suggests that NO is involved in pH(i) regulation during focal cerebral ischemia.

The effects of the N-methyl-D-aspartate (NMDA) antagonist MK-801 on capillary beds and CBF following 1 h of transient incomplete focal cerebral ischemia were studied by examining 133Xe CBF, capillary diameter, and area of perfused vasculature. Capillary diameter increased from a control of 5.24 +/- 0.37 to 8.62 +/- 0.57 microns (p less than 0.001) and area of perfused vasculature from 20,943 +/- 1,151 to 30,442 +/- 1,691 microns2/x 10 magnification field (p less than 0.001) with MK-801 1.0 mg/kg administered 30 min prior to ischemia. After flow restoration in control animals, there was a relative hypoperfusion with eventual normalization of CBF over 60 min. Alternatively, in MK-801 1.0 mg/kg animals, there was rapid normalization of CBF upon flow restoration without the postischemic hypoperfusion observed in controls. On histological analysis, there was consistently less neuronal edema in MK-801-treated animals. These results support the hypothesis that hypoperfusion following incomplete focal cerebral ischemia may be due in part to NMDA-mediated cellular edema with subsequent extravascular capillary bed compression.

The effects of the novel dihydronaphthyridine Ca2+ antagonist CI-951 on focal cerebral ischemia were assessed during MCA occlusion in 30 white New Zealand rabbits under 1.0% halothane anesthesia. In vivo brain pHi and focal CBF were measured with umbelliferone fluorescence. Baseline normocapnic brain pHi and CBF were 7.02 +/- 0.02 and 48.4 +/- 2.9 ml/100 g/min, respectively. In the severe ischemic regions, 15 min postocclusion brain pHi and CBF were 6.62 +/- 0.04 and 14.4 +/- 0.7 ml/100 g/min in controls vs. 6.60 +/- 0.02 and 12.9 +/- 2.3 ml/100 g/min, respectively, in animals destined to receive CI-951. Twenty minutes after MCA occlusion, CI-951 was administered at 0.5 microgram/kg/min and brain pHi and CBF were determined in both regions of severe and moderate ischemia for 4 h postocclusion. Control severe ischemic sites demonstrated no significant improvement in brain pHi and only mild increases in CBF over the next 4 h. CI-951 caused significant improvement in both of these parameters. Postocclusion 4 h brain pHi and CBF measured 6.69 +/- 0.04 and 18.5 +/- 3.2 ml/100 g/min in controls vs. 7.01 +/- 0.04 and 41.7 +/- 5.3 ml/100 g/min, respectively, in CI-951 animals (p less than 0.001). Similar improvements were observed in moderate ischemic sites. In animals that demonstrated postocclusion EEG attenuation, 75% of CI-951 animals had EEG recovery as compared to 18% in controls. CI-951 may be a useful therapeutic agent for focal cerebral ischemia if histological and outcome studies verify these data.

Intracellular brain pH and indicator tissue perfusion were measured with a lipid-soluble, pH-sensitive fluorescent indicator in 10 rabbits who had either severe or moderate focal ischemia depending on whether the middle cerebral artery was occluded at its main trunk or bifurcation. Preocclusion tissue indicator perfusion was 50.1 ml/100 g/min and intracellular brain pH was 7.03. In severe focal ischemia, immediate postocclusion tissue perfusion was 12.7 ml/100 g/min and intracellular brain pH was 6.64. Four hours after occlusion, the perfusion was 5.2 ml/100 g/min and intracellular brain pH was 6.08. There was EEG and histological confirmation of infarction. In the moderate focal ischemia group, immediate postocclusion flow was 20.0 ml/100 g/min and intracellular brain pH was 6.92. At 3 h, postocclusion tissue perfusion was 22.6 ml/100 g/min and intracellular brain pH was 6.86. Therefore, for the first 3 h, this ischemic penumbra was stable. At the fourth hour, both cerebral tissue perfusion and intracellular brain pH worsened. This suggests that the ischemic penumbra is a dynamic state. The rabbit is a good experimental model for the production of both severe and moderate focal ischemia.

Gene therapy is being investigated as a putative treatment option for cardiovascular diseases, including cerebral vasospasm. Because there is presently no information regarding gene transfer to human cerebral arteries, the principal objective of this study was to characterize adenovirus-mediated expression and function of recombinant endothelial nitric oxide synthase (eNOS) gene in human pial arteries. Pial arteries (outer diameter 500 to 1,000 microm) were isolated from 30 patients undergoing temporal lobectomy for intractable seizures and were studied using histologic staining, histochemistry, electron microscopy, and isometric force recording. Gene transfer experiments were performed ex vivo using adenoviral vectors encoding genes for bovine eNOS (AdCMVeNOS) and Escherichia coli beta-galactosidase (AdCMVLacZ). In transduced arteries, studied 24 hours after exposure to vectors, expression of recombinant beta-galactosidase and eNOS was detected by histochemistry, localizing mainly to the adventitia (n = 4). Immunoelectron microscopy localized recombinant eNOS in adventitial fibroblasts. During contractions to U46619, bradykinin-induced relaxations were significantly augmented in AdCMVeNOS-transduced rings compared with control and AdCMVLacZ-transduced rings (P < 0.01; n = 6). The NOS inhibitor L-nitroarginine methylester (L-NAME) caused significantly greater contraction in AdCMVeNOS-transduced rings (P < 0.001; n = 4) and inhibited bradykinin-induced relaxations in control and transduced rings (P < 0.001; n = 6). The current findings suggest that in AdCMVeNOS-transduced human pial arteries, expression of recombinant eNOS occurs mainly in adventitial fibroblasts where it augments relaxations to NO-dependent agonists such as bradykinin. Findings from the current study might be beneficial in future clinical applications of gene therapy for the treatment or prevention of cerebral vasospasm.

Temporal lobectomy is an effective treatment for medically intractable seizures. The change in seizure status with prolonged postoperative follow-up is unclear. The authors followed 37 patients who underwent first time temporal lobectomy during childhood for at least 15 years. This study is the longest follow-up of children who have had a temporal lobectomy for intractable seizures. It demonstrates that seizure recurrence can increase with longer duration of follow-up.

OBJECTIVES: To determine whether localization of extratemporal epilepsy with subtraction ictal SPECT coregistered with MRI (SISCOM) is predictive of outcome after resective epilepsy surgery, whether SISCOM images provide prognostically important information compared with standard tests, and whether blood flow change on SISCOM images is useful in determining site and extent of excision required. BACKGROUND: The value of SISCOM in predicting surgical outcome for extratemporal epilepsy is unknown, especially if MRI findings are nonlocalizing. METHODS: SISCOM images in 36 consecutive patients were classified by blinded reviewers as "localizing and concordant with site of surgery," "localizing but nonconcordant with site of surgery," or "nonlocalizing." SISCOM images were coregistered with postoperative MRI, and reviewers visually determined whether cerebral cortex underlying the SISCOM focus had been completely resected, partially resected, or not resected. RESULTS: Twenty-four patients (66.7%) had localizing SISCOM, including 13 (76.5%) of those without a focal MRI lesion. Eleven of 19 patients (57.9%) with localizing SISCOM concordant with the surgical site, compared with 3 of 17 (17.6%) with nonlocalizing or nonconcordant SISCOM, had an excellent outcome (p < 0.05). With logistic regression analysis, SISCOM findings were predictive of postsurgical outcome, independently of MRI or scalp ictal EEG findings (p < 0.05). The extent of resection of the cortical region of the SISCOM focus was significantly associated with the rate of excellent outcome (100% with complete resection, 60% with partial resection, and 20% with nonresection, p < 0.05). CONCLUSION: SISCOM images may be useful in guiding the location and extent of resection in extratemporal epilepsy surgery.

We investigated the relationship between preoperative MRI hippocampal volumes and clinical neuropsychological memory test data obtained before and after temporal lobectomy and amygdalohippocampectomy for intractable epilepsy in 44 left (LTL) and 36 right (RTL) temporal lobectomy patients. In LTL patients, the difference (right minus left hippocampal volume) between hippocampal volumes (DHF) was significantly (p < 0.001) correlated (r = 0.61) with postoperative verbal memory change as measured by a delayed memory percent retention score from the Wechsler Memory Scale-Revised, Logical Memory subtest. DHF was also positively associated with postoperative memory for abstract geometric designs in LTL patients (r = 0.49, p < 0.005). Resection of a relatively nonatrophic left hippocampus was associated with poorer verbal and visual memory outcome. In RTL patients, larger right adjusted (for total intracranial volume) hippocampal volume was associated with decline in visual-spatial learning, but not memory, following surgery. MRI hippocampal volume data appear to provide meaningful information in evaluating the risk for memory impairment following temporal lobectomy.

OBJECTIVE: To determine whether the detection of focal hypoperfusion by subtraction SPECT co-registered to MRI (SISCOM) improves the sensitivity and specificity of postictal SPECT in intractable partial epilepsy. BACKGROUND: Postictal SPECT injections are easier to perform than are ictal injections, but the images are more difficult to interpret and have been reported to have lower sensitivity and specificity. METHODS: Thirty-five consecutive intractable partial epilepsy patients who had postictal SPECT studies were evaluated. The following sets of SPECT images were separately interpreted by three blinded reviewers and classified as either localizing to 1 of 16 possible sites in the brain or as nonlocalizing: unsubtracted postictal and interictal images for conventional side-by-side comparison, SISCOM images of hyperperfusion, SISCOM images of hypoperfusion, and both sets of SISCOM hyperperfusion and hypoperfusion images (combined SISCOM evaluation). RESULTS: Significantly higher proportions of the hyperperfusion SISCOM images (65.7%), the hypoperfusion SISCOM images (74.3%), and the combined SISCOM evaluation (82.9%) were localizing than were the conventional method of side-by-side comparison of unsubtracted images (31.4%; p < 0.0001). Concordance with the discharge diagnosis was higher for the combined SISCOM evaluation than it was for either the hyperperfusion or the hypoperfusion SISCOM images alone (both p < 0.05). For the hypoperfusion SISCOM and the combined SISCOM evaluations, concordance of the localization with the site of epilepsy surgery was associated with a greater probability of an excellent outcome than were nonconcordant/nonlocalizing images (both p < 0.05). CONCLUSION: The use of SISCOM to detect focal cerebral hypoperfusion, in addition to focal hyperperfusion, improves the sensitivity and specificity of postictal SPECT in intractable partial epilepsy.

Since clear cell meningioma has only recently been recognized as a morphologic entity, its pathobiology has not been studied. Fourteen examples occurring in seven females and six males, ages 9 to 82 years (mean 29 years), were examined; one was associated with type 2 neurofibromatosis. Of these cases, seven (50%) were spinal-intradural (six lumbar, one thoracic), three (21%) arose in the posterior fossa (cerebellopontine angle), three (21%) were supratentorial, and one (7%) was centered upon the foramen magnum. In one case (8%), two tumors were considered to be independent primaries. One tumor (8%) appeared to show no dural attachment. Thirteen tumors were subject to complete study. All were composed of sheets of clear, glycogen-rich, polygonal cells forming only a few vague whorls. Hyalinization, both stromal and perivascular, was often extensive. Mitoses were rare in primary tumors. Immunohistochemistry showed vimentin and epithelial membrane antigen staining to be reactive in 100%. Stains for S-100 protein and CAM 5.2 were negative. Progesterone and estrogen receptor staining was observed in 77% and 0%, respectively. Ultrastructural study showed abundant cytoplasmic glycogen, a few cytoplasmic lumina, intermediate filaments, interdigitation of cell membranes, and desmosomal junctions. The means, medians, and ranges of proliferating cell nuclear antigen (PCNA) and MIB-1 antigen labeling indices for nonrecurring and recurring tumors were 10.4%, 8.8%, 0.8-23.4% and 11%, 1.4%, 0.1-50.3%, as compared with 7.4%, 6.7%, 2.9-17.2% and 13.3%, 13.4%, 3.3-25.7%, respectively. Twelve successful DNA ploidy studies showed that 11 tumors (85%) were diploid and one was tetraploid; percentage S-phase determinations varied from 4 to 9% (mean 6.0%). Recurrence was noted in eight patients (61%) (five of whom had multiple recurrences); there was local discontinuous spread in two cases (15%) and widespread cranial to spinal metastasis in one case (8%). Three patients (23%) are dead of disease. In summary, clear cell meningiomas are morphologically unique, show no sex predilection, affect primarily the lumbar region and cerebellopontine angle, and despite their benign appearance, may be inordinately aggressive, particularly intracranial examples. No close association was noted between recurrence or clinical outcome and such factors as mitotic activity, PCNA proliferation indices, percent S-phase determination, or DNA ploidy status. In contrast, MIB-1 proliferation indices were appreciably higher among recurring tumors.

It is has been suggested that rhabdoid morphology is associated with a poor prognosis, regardless of tumor histogenesis. We report a series of 15 meningiomas with rhabdoid features. Nine patients had undergone multiple resections. In six, the rhabdoid component was histologically apparent only in recurrences. Rhabdoid morphology was defined as sheets of loosely cohesive cells with eccentric nuclei and hyaline, paranuclear inclusions. Ultrastructurally, the latter consisted of whorls of intermediate filaments often entrapping lysosomes or other organelles. Meningothelial features included whorl formation and nuclear pseudoinclusions, immunohistochemical coexpression of vimentin and epithelial membrane antigen, and the ultrastructural finding of interdigitating cell membranes and intercellular junctions. At the histologic level, a conventional meningioma component was noted in most tumors; only four lesions were entirely rhabdoid. Histologic malignancy (brain invasion or anaplasia) was observed in nine cases, another two tumors being considered malignant on the basis of extracranial metastasis. In the majority, increased cell proliferation was evidenced by a high mitotic rate or MIB-1 LI. At last follow-up, 13 patients (87%) had experienced at least one recurrence and 8 (53%) were dead of disease. Median time to death was 5.8 years after initial surgery and 3.1 years after the first appearance of rhabdoid morphology. Our findings corroborate those from a smaller series recently reported by Kepes et al. on the same entity (Kepes JJ, Moral LA, Wilkinson SB, Abdullah A, Llena JF. Rhabdoid transformation of tumor cells in meningiomas: A histologic indication of increased proliferative activity. Report of four cases. Am J Surg Pathol 1998;22:231-8). They further suggest that rhabdoid meningiomas are highly aggressive tumors and that the rhabdoid phenotype represents a marker of malignant transformation in meningiomas.

Increased intracranial pressure can result in irreversible injury to the central nervous system. Among the many functions of the cerebrospinal fluid, it provides protection against acute changes in venous and arterial blood pressure or impact pressure. Nevertheless, trauma, tumors, infections, neurosurgical procedures, and other factors can cause increased intracranial pressure. Both surgical and nonsurgical therapeutic modalities can be used in the management of increased intracranial pressure attributable to traumatic and nontraumatic causes. In patients with cerebral injury and increased intracranial pressure, monitoring of the intracranial pressure can provide an objective measure of the response to therapy and the pressure dynamics. Intraventricular, intraparenchymal, subarachnoid, and epidural sites can be used for monitoring, and the advantages and disadvantages of the various devices available are discussed. With the proper understanding of the physiologic features of the cerebrospinal fluid, the physician can apply the management principles reviewed herein to minimize damage from intracranial hypertension.

OBJECTIVE: To discuss the clinical features of moyamoya disease, the studies that aid in diagnosing this disorder, and the reported outcomes of surgical treatment. DESIGN: We review the manifestations of moyamoya disease in children and adults and the recent reports of the various surgical procedures. MATERIAL AND METHODS: Moyamoya disease is a chronic cerebrovascular disorder in which stenosis of the major arteries of the circle of Willis at the base of the skull progresses to occlusion. The diagnosis is based on the angiographic findings of the "puff of smoke" appearance of the abnormal capillary vessels at the base of the skull. Three surgical procedures are used to manage this disease: anastomosis of the superficial temporal artery to the middle cerebral artery, encephalomyosynangiosis, and encephaloduro-arteriosynangiosis. RESULTS: In children with this disease, cerebral ischemic events, including strokes, occur. In adults, the fragile abnormal vessels can rupture and cause intracerebral hemorrhage. The mortality rate for adults is higher than that for children. Most published reports support the efficacy of surgical treatment in children but not in adults. CONCLUSIONS: The natural history of moyamoya disease is poor; neurologic deterioration due to strokes and hemorrhage is progressive. Seizures and intellectual deterioration can occur.

OBJECTIVE: To review our recent experience with surgical treatment of patients with vascular malformations and intractable partial epilepsy. DESIGN: We retrospectively studied 20 consecutive Mayo patients who had undergone surgical treatment of medically refractory partial epilepsy and had cerebral vascular malformations. MATERIAL AND METHODS: Seizures were the initial symptom in all 13 female and 7 male patients, none of whom had a history of a symptomatic intracerebral hemorrhage. Magnetic resonance imaging (MRI) or pathologic examination, or both, indicated the presence of remote hemorrhage associated with the vascular lesion in 18 patients. MRI disclosed 36 vascular malformations (32 cavernous and 4 arteriovenous malformations) in the 20 patients. MRI was more sensitive and specific than computed tomography for their detection and characterization. The operative strategy in all patients included complete resection of the vascular malformation. A modified Engel classification (based on four classes) was used to determine the outcome of seizures. RESULTS: Postoperatively, 15 patients were free of seizures, and 3 patients had at least a 90% decrease in number of seizures. Only two patients had an unfavorable outcome. Neither the age at onset of seizures nor the duration of seizures seemed to affect the outcome. The site of the vascular malformation was less important than precise correlation between the site of onset of seizure activity and the corresponding vascular malformation. The presence of coexistent ipsilateral atrophy of the hippocampal formation should be sought, and the operative strategy should be appropriately modified. CONCLUSION: In the absence of dual pathologic conditions, lesionectomy can yield a seizure-free outcome in patients with intractable partial epilepsy and cerebral vascular malformations.

Between 1971 and 1989, 749 carotid endarterectomies were performed at our institution for symptomatic carotid occlusive disease in patients older than 70 years of age. Of these procedures, 693 were done in patients 71 through 80 years of age, and 56 were done in patients between the ages of 81 and 90 years. The neurologic morbidity and perioperative mortality in the former group were 2.9% and 1.4%, respectively, whereas in the latter group the corresponding values were 5.4% and 0%, respectively. For the entire group, the neurologic morbidity was 3.1% and the mortality was 1.3%. Of the 23 new postoperative neurologic deficits, 19 (83%) occurred in high-risk patients with severe preoperative neurologic or medical risks, and 14 (61%) of these deficits were minor. In selected elderly patients with symptomatic hemodynamically significant carotid occlusive disease, endarterectomy seems to be a safe procedure that is associated with acceptably low perioperative morbidity and mortality.

OBJECTIVE: To examine the medical and surgical aspects of intracranial aneurysms, including the pathogenesis, clinical manifestations, management of subarachnoid hemorrhage (SAH), and indications for surgical intervention. DESIGN: This review presents the classification of intracranial aneurysms, defines specific aneurysms, and analyzes the Mayo Clinic experience with surgical treatment of cerebral aneurysms. MATERIAL AND METHODS: Intracranial aneurysms are classified by cause, size, site, and shape. The clinical grading systems for SAH, the most common manifestation, are as follows: modified Botterell, Hunt and Hess, and World Federation of Neurological Surgeons. Surgical options are direct clipping, interventional neuroradiologic treatment, proximal ligation or trapping of aneurysms, and wrapping or coating of aneurysms. Although the timing of surgical intervention after SAH is controversial, it should be based on the clinical grade, site of the aneurysm, and patient's medical condition. RESULTS: The frequency of intracranial aneurysms is estimated to be 1 to 8% in the general population, and 90% of patients have SAH. After SAH, 8 to 60% of patients die before they get to a hospital. After hospitalization, the mortality rate is 37%, severe disability is 17%, and outcome is favorable in 47%. The current trend for surgical treatment is early after SAH. The Mayo Clinic experience with 1,947 patients who underwent surgical treatment because of aneurysmal SAH or for aneurysmal repair between 1969 and 1990 is as follows: 1,445 had an excellent outcome, 231 had a good outcome, 171 had a poor outcome, and 100 died. CONCLUSION: Aggressive management can be beneficial for many patients with severe neurologic injury after SAH by preventing rerupture of the aneurysm, attenuating the severity and sequelae of vasospasm, and decreasing the surgical complications.

Although approximately 500,000 patients suffer from a stroke each year in the United States, treatment of these patients to date has consisted primarily of prevention, supportive measures, and rehabilitation. The modification of experimental cerebral infarction by new pharmacologic agents, along with encouraging results from the restoration of blood flow to areas of focal ischemia in both laboratory and clinical trials, suggests that a more aggressive approach might be considered in selected patients with acute stroke.

Neurologic involvement occurs in 10% to 20% of patients with disseminated histoplasmosis. We describe a 20-year-old woman who had headache and diplopia but no evidence of systemic infection. Magnetic resonance imaging showed an enhancing mass in the thalamomesencephalic and third ventricular region. After subtotal resection of what was presumed to be a glioma, the patient had symptoms and signs of meningitis. Subsequent pathological review demonstrated noncaseating granulomas, and serologic tests and cultures confirmed the diagnosis of histoplasmosis. Initiation of antifungal therapy and removal of an infected shunt system resulted in clinical improvement. Clinicians should maintain a high index of suspicion in patients who are from any area endemic for histoplasmosis.
